Alcoholics Anonymous ads clean up in second round of Sirens

A campaign for Alcoholics Anonymous has made a clean sweep of round two of the radio Sirens.

  

The single ad “Mummy”, created by Gatecrasher Advertising in Perth, won the overall, single and craft categories. It was one of four ads in the campaign which took out the campaign category overall.

The ads’ writer Des Hameister said the spots empathise with the fact that alcoholics don’t just hurt themselves.
